    Loblaws Calgary AB buys 50 trucks.
    Just hired 50 experienced drivers.
    They'll do it again soon.
    To do AB-CA moving meat loads SB and coming back with produce.
    61 CPM+1 CPM safety bonus=62 CPM. Canadian dollars, of course.
    I think they are the highest payer in the Western Canada right now.
    We are talking company drivers here. With full benefits.
    They are still a horrible employer, in my humble view.
